From patchwork Mon Mar 17 13:49:26 2025 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Nicolas Frattaroli X-Patchwork-Id: 14019489 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from bombadil.infradead.org (bombadil.infradead.org [198.137.202.133]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by smtp.lore.kernel.org (Postfix) with ESMTPS id 40DDCC35FFF for ; Mon, 17 Mar 2025 14:08:36 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=lists.infradead.org; s=bombadil.20210309; h=Sender:List-Subscribe:List-Help :List-Post:List-Archive:List-Unsubscribe:List-Id:Cc:To:In-Reply-To:References :Message-Id:Content-Transfer-Encoding:Content-Type:MIME-Version:Subject:Date: From:Reply-To:Content-ID:Content-Description:Resent-Date:Resent-From: Resent-Sender:Resent-To:Resent-Cc:Resent-Message-ID:List-Owner; bh=vTJZMXEurjXX++PH2hmwuc7IJOgr6HvrWn3KlD6bDXs=; b=DnNTSGF3JVDSv1+VQZ5XDHv91q bF+4bPEqiXdm7wHQzFbwrrfNicQBXKxydelzgT8pxcppAWGy8Tg1gPQzewmrvnaebLWQIFe4+OqFJ hchdAvvAWPDAzmQ09UwcxlSL0evjkhz4uggP50yf8tCHlwqV24Aw68GNbzzQCeMX3QihddCkGaxaW Oa8os4O1Ms84UDfOeQD5wz1pgBK+3YIXUQ5g5Ns8IKCF2u/Fg99N6kvSXe1soQi3vCJ1Z/BsJsU65 tbk4NggYp3u6wZO1YBWj7aPr1egcZX0s1Wg42xO2OfQKJvoFSHYXjFZy3ce8dEk72UQl3RUFyEe9r 1O//1LFA==; Received: from localhost ([::1] helo=bombadil.infradead.org) by bombadil.infradead.org with esmtp (Exim 4.98 #2 (Red Hat Linux)) id 1tuB8i-00000002r1d-2oLX; Mon, 17 Mar 2025 14:08:24 +0000 Received: from sender4-pp-f112.zoho.com ([136.143.188.112]) by bombadil.infradead.org with esmtps (Exim 4.98 #2 (Red Hat Linux)) id 1tuArT-00000002nyJ-2LVP; Mon, 17 Mar 2025 13:50:36 +0000 ARC-Seal: i=1; a=rsa-sha256; t=1742219423; cv=none; d=zohomail.com; s=zohoarc; b=jTUQ3+B3Jdh6ejfaMBnfAgWEiEpN+M4tloQJpU7rikYKYQnB4Dixm/BkULndJebb+XASDYrwjjcEp5Vi8UEt98JsjvdmSCc793rYTrlE2dhQ2nTSGvf6IBixNnTRSCCqeiCA+plALDlKE4IKVBdHt0zV02WsOT6xWZmZhi0wBxI= 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=zohomail.com; s=zohoarc; t=1742219423; h=Content-Type:Content-Transfer-Encoding:Cc:Cc:Date:Date:From:From:In-Reply-To:MIME-Version:Message-ID:References:Subject:Subject:To:To:Message-Id:Reply-To; bh=vTJZMXEurjXX++PH2hmwuc7IJOgr6HvrWn3KlD6bDXs=; b=WyQhIdC3jtYRZP5irqzIwsWJGzEYWr/R0ZRvj8vu1YXdnwd/FQnbtxCv+kWk+zskOW3D9EFD6HFDqh4paPo2UfyE2S+3VcBTot6fyN3FXLa6yBXFGdoHUKEOdr1A1Q6nuEHN6M0CuoQY0Kw0uCtH1CN8OACphDOKgJbchfDuBz4= ARC-Authentication-Results: i=1; mx.zohomail.com; dkim=pass header.i=collabora.com; spf=pass smtp.mailfrom=nicolas.frattaroli@collabora.com; dmarc=pass header.from= D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; t=1742219423; s=zohomail; d=collabora.com; i=nicolas.frattaroli@collabora.com; h=From:From:Date:Date:Subject:Subject:MIME-Version:Content-Type:Content-Transfer-Encoding:Message-Id:Message-Id:References:In-Reply-To:To:To:Cc:Cc:Reply-To; bh=vTJZMXEurjXX++PH2hmwuc7IJOgr6HvrWn3KlD6bDXs=; b=kuvvtxa/F1QMRJ6TH1gRdomRSkeIA6gRvbwHcY+46N9jQAmkZeBjtQhSRhp8AYJ5 OufTGyej15B0LRGWDkL5lXxs1OWF+zl2PmvKUVjNN+qvQNc8IbBVSsYfuTPOk6hL5z3 Q3/71TAtFeYWX0mB8a7TnhT+gtpXz9C7uMav0S4s= Received: by mx.zohomail.com with SMTPS id 1742219422229957.2183576646732; Mon, 17 Mar 2025 06:50:22 -0700 (PDT) From: Nicolas Frattaroli Date: Mon, 17 Mar 2025 14:49:26 +0100 Subject: [PATCH v4 1/7] thermal: rockchip: rename rk_tsadcv3_tshut_mode MIME-Version: 1.0 Message-Id: <20250317-rk3576-tsadc-upstream-v4-1-c5029ce55d74@collabora.com> References: <20250317-rk3576-tsadc-upstream-v4-0-c5029ce55d74@collabora.com> In-Reply-To: <20250317-rk3576-tsadc-upstream-v4-0-c5029ce55d74@collabora.com> To: "Rafael J. Wysocki" , Daniel Lezcano , Zhang Rui , Lukasz Luba , Rob Herring , Krzysztof Kozlowski , Conor Dooley , Heiko Stuebner , Jonas Karlman Cc: Sebastian Reichel , kernel@collabora.com, linux-pm@vger.kernel.org, devicetree@vger.kernel.org, linux-arm-kernel@lists.infradead.org, linux-rockchip@lists.infradead.org, linux-kernel@vger.kernel.org, Nicolas Frattaroli X-Mailer: b4 0.14.2 X-CRM114-Version: 20100106-BlameMichelson ( TRE 0.8.0 (BSD) ) MR-646709E3 X-CRM114-CacheID: sfid-20250317_065035_673426_148CDD98 X-CRM114-Status: GOOD ( 11.75 ) X-BeenThere: linux-arm-kernel@lists.infradead.org X-Mailman-Version: 2.1.34 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Sender: "linux-arm-kernel" Errors-To: linux-arm-kernel-bounces+linux-arm-kernel=archiver.kernel.org@lists.infradead.org The "v" version specifier here refers to the hardware IP revision. Mainline deviated from downstream here by calling the v4 revision v3 as it didn't support the v3 hardware revision at all. This creates needless confusion, so rename it to rk_tsadcv4_tshut_mode to be consistent with what the hardware wants to be called. Signed-off-by: Nicolas Frattaroli --- drivers/thermal/rockchip_thermal.c |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/drivers/thermal/rockchip_thermal.c b/drivers/thermal/rockchip_thermal.c index a8ad85feb68fbb7ec8d79602b16c47838ecb3c00..40c7d234c3ef99f69dd8db4d8c47f9d493c0583d 100644 --- a/drivers/thermal/rockchip_thermal.c +++ b/drivers/thermal/rockchip_thermal.c @@ -1045,7 +1045,7 @@ static void rk_tsadcv2_tshut_mode(int chn, void __iomem *regs, writel_relaxed(val, regs + TSADCV2_INT_EN); } -static void rk_tsadcv3_tshut_mode(int chn, void __iomem *regs, +static void rk_tsadcv4_tshut_mode(int chn, void __iomem *regs, enum tshut_mode mode) { u32 val_gpio, val_cru; @@ -1297,7 +1297,7 @@ static const struct rockchip_tsadc_chip rk3588_tsadc_data = { .get_temp = rk_tsadcv4_get_temp, .set_alarm_temp = rk_tsadcv3_alarm_temp, .set_tshut_temp = rk_tsadcv3_tshut_temp, - .set_tshut_mode = rk_tsadcv3_tshut_mode, + .set_tshut_mode = rk_tsadcv4_tshut_mode, .table = { .id = rk3588_code_table, .length = ARRAY_SIZE(rk3588_code_table),